    • An organic electroluminescence panel comprises a supporting substrate, a lower electrode, an organic layer including at least a luminescence layer, an upper electrode, an inorganic layer which has a refractive index in the range of 1.7 to 3.0 and which has a concave-convex structure having a surface roughness of 10 to 10 μm formed at an outermost surface on a light extraction side, an adhesive layer, and a light extraction substrate formed therein in this order. Preferably, the inorganic layer comprises plural layers, a layer including the outermost surface at the light extraction side is a high-refractive-index layer having a refractive index of 2.1 to 3.0, and at least one of the other layers among the plural layers is a gas barrier layer having higher gas barrier properties than those of the high-refractive-index layer.
    • 有机电致发光面板包括支撑衬底,下电极,至少包含发光层的有机层,上电极,折射率在1.7〜3.0范围内的无机层,并且具有凹凸结构 在光取出侧的最表面形成10〜10μm的表面粗糙度,粘合层,以及依次形成的光提取基板。 优选地,无机层包括多层,在光提取侧包括最外表面的层是折射率为2.1〜3.0的高折射率层,多层中的至少其中一层为 具有比高折射率层高的阻气性的阻气层。
